About this home
306 SE 256 STREET
WATERFRONT OPPORTUNITY IN SUWANNEE WITH THREE LOTS, PRIVATE BOAT RAMP & CANAL ACCESS. This unique property includes a total of three lots situated on a canal with a concrete seawall, private boat ramp, and RV hookup. Located on a quiet dead-end road with federally owned land across the street, the property offers added privacy and a natural setting that's hard to find. The home offers 3 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ms and is being sold AS-IS after sustaining hurricane damage. It has been completely gutted, providing the next owner with the opportunity to renovate or rebuild to their own vision. Prior to the storm, the home received significant updates including a metal roof, impact-rated storm windows, and an HVAC system, all less than five years old. Power remains connected to the home. The spacious primary suite features a generously sized bedroom along with an attached sitting area that offers endless possibilities. This flexible space could serve as a home office, reading nook, nursery, hobby area, or additional sleeping space and provides access to the private porch overlooking the canal. Outdoor features include a covered fish cleaning station, a screened porch off the living room with sliding glass doors, and an additional screened side porch. Tongue-and-groove ceilings remain in the living room, kitchen, and rear screened porch, preserving the home's coastal character. With direct access to the Suwannee River and the Gulf of Mexico, this property is ideal for boating, fishing, and enjoying Florida's waterfront lifestyle.
